Anyone can be nominated by any MRA Member, but the nominee MUST become an MRA member before accepting the nomination.
The Vice President and the VP of Rules and Tech positions can be held by riders or non-riders.
The Treasurer position is a non-riding position as the duties associated carry through both race days.
The New Rider Director and Rider Representative positions must be held by racers so that they may maintain the rider's perspective, teach and coach throughout the season.
In addition to being a "voice" of the racing membership, there are 4 distinct "Rider Rep Positions" and specific responsibilities that come with each:
Rulebook - responsible for knowing rulebook inside and out, compiling new rule suggestions, coordinating and conducting rulebook committee meeting, and then presenting committee recommendations to the Board. Also requires making edits, corrections, etc... to rulebook as necessary, and then preparing rulebook text for the publishing company as per their guidelines. The majority of the work in this position occurs "off season".
Trophy and Class Sponsorship - responsible for contacting existing and prospective trophy sponsors to ensure classes are sponsored for race season. Must negotiate sponsorships, giving first right of refusal to returning class sponsors. Prepares and delivers invoices to trophy sponsors, and provides ongoing contact with trophy sponsors as necessary. Also responsible for contracting, ordering, and delivering trophies to MRA events and Award Ceremony. The workload for this position is fairly evenly spread throughout the calendar year.
Public Relations/Events - responsible for heading up and coordinating local/regional PR events with members and volunteers, and the construction, maintenance and distribution of E-Displays. Orders flyers, staff's events (bike nights, dealership open houses, etc...), posts on other club sites, communicates with Board regarding marketing expenditures, etc... This is NOT a one-man-band position. It requires someone who can coordinate and motivate members to attend various functions and keep tabs on ALL PR events to be sure the MRA is properly represented. This position requires attention and effort throughout the calendar year.
Press / Communications - responsible for sending out results press releases immediately following the race weekend, primarily to Roadracing World and other race oriented magazines/websites. Also responsible for sending notifications to membership via MailChimp and updating MRA Facebook page and Twitter Account. Updates and maintains the MRA Hotline, collects the mail from the Post Office, and cross-posts relevant information to other club sites as necessary. This position also assists the Vice President with contingency duties including contacting current and prospective contingency sponsors to ensure continued support in next season, phone and e-mail work to confirm forms, payouts, etc..., and assists in timely filing of contingency forms throughout the season. The workload for this position is year-round, but the heaviest load is immediately preceding, and during the race season.
